022.phpt 818 B

1234567891011121314151617181920212223242526272829303132333435363738
  1. --TEST--
  2. Cookies test#1
  3. --INI--
  4. max_input_vars=1000
  5. filter.default=unsafe_raw
  6. --COOKIE--
  7. cookie1=val1 ; cookie2=val2%20; cookie3=val 3.; cookie 4= value 4 %3B; cookie1=bogus; %20cookie1=ignore;+cookie1=ignore;cookie1;cookie 5=%20 value; cookie%206=þæö;cookie+7=;$cookie.8;cookie-9=1;;;- & % $cookie 10=10
  8. --FILE--
  9. <?php
  10. var_dump($_COOKIE);
  11. ?>
  12. --EXPECT--
  13. array(12) {
  14. ["cookie1"]=>
  15. string(6) "val1 "
  16. ["cookie2"]=>
  17. string(5) "val2 "
  18. ["cookie3"]=>
  19. string(6) "val 3."
  20. ["cookie_4"]=>
  21. string(10) " value 4 ;"
  22. ["%20cookie1"]=>
  23. string(6) "ignore"
  24. ["+cookie1"]=>
  25. string(6) "ignore"
  26. ["cookie__5"]=>
  27. string(7) " value"
  28. ["cookie%206"]=>
  29. string(3) "þæö"
  30. ["cookie+7"]=>
  31. string(0) ""
  32. ["$cookie_8"]=>
  33. string(0) ""
  34. ["cookie-9"]=>
  35. string(1) "1"
  36. ["-_&_%_$cookie_10"]=>
  37. string(2) "10"
  38. }